Slotted spring pins are typically one piece with a slot on one side that stays stationary once it is installed.
Coiled spring pins have an internal coil that remains more dynamic after installation which helps the fasteners absorb shock from the assembly and provides more flexibility than a slotted style.

A spring pin also called tension pin or roll pin is a mechanical fastener that secures the position of two or more parts of a machine relative to each other.
